Google faces lawsuit over alleged infringement of artificial intelligence patents

This post is also available in: 简体中文 (Chinese)

In Boston, Google faces a patent infringement lawsuit filed by Singular Computing involving its artificial intelligence processor.

Singular Computing accused Google of illegally using its patented technology to develop tensor processing units (TPUs) and initially sought damages of up to $7 billion. Court documents show that Google denies the infringement accusations, calling the Singular patent “dubious” and saying that its TPU is different from the patented technology.

Another case involving the validity of the Singular patent is currently before the U.S. Court of Appeals. The dispute could have a major impact on the field of artificial intelligence and technology giants.

According to a report by Air Street Capital, Google and Meta have the highest citation rates in the field of artificial intelligence research since 2020.
